Company mission

Acast empowers and enables podcast creatives to share amazing stories, find their valuable audience, and make money out of their craft.

Acast is a podcast hosting platform, monetized by its ad network. Users gain access to a variety of tools including sharing tools and advanced analytics, and earn money via the adverts provided by the Acast service. Acast publish podcasts to all podcast apps such as Amazon, Spotify and Apple Podcasts.

The Acast is the platform is used by worldwide brands such as the Guardian, BBC, HuffPost, VICE, Vougue and the Financial Times. It enables creators and advertisers to foster meaningful relationships with listeners, while giving anyone access to insightful, educational, and entertaining audio content.

In 2021, Acast acquired competitor RadioPublic, making Acast the biggest podcast platform in the US. With this acquisition, Acast will bring more features to its platform including the ability for podcasters to set up dedicated websites for their shows and a targeted text messaging feature.
